One key aspect in finding budget-friendly insurance is understanding the different types of coverage available. In Canada, auto insurance typically includes liability, collision, and comprehensive coverage. Liability insurance is mandatory and protects you against damages or injuries you may cause to others in an accident. Collision insurance covers damage to your vehicle after an accident, while comprehensive coverage protects against non-collision-related incidents such as theft or weather damage.

For many drivers, opting for a higher deductible can significantly lower premium costs. A deductible is the amount you agree to pay out-of-pocket before your insurance kicks in. By increasing this amount, your monthly premiums can decrease, making even comprehensive coverage more affordable.

Several insurance providers in Canada are known for their competitive rates. Companies like Intact Insurance, Aviva, and The Co-operators often offer affordable auto insurance plans. Consumers should compare quotes from multiple insurers to ensure they find the best rate possible. Furthermore, many companies provide discounts for safe driving records, bundling policies, or completing driver safety courses.

Another strategy to consider is seeking out group insurance plans. Some employers or professional associations offer group insurance policies that can provide reduced rates for members. This can make a considerable difference in affordability compared to individual plans.

In addition to comparing quotes and seeking discounts, drivers should regularly assess their coverage needs. If an older vehicle has depreciated significantly, switching from collision and comprehensive coverage to liability-only might be more cost-effective. This step can help reduce premiums while still maintaining the necessary legal coverage.
